Title of article :
On the Urbach rule in non-crystalline solids

Abstract :
A comparative analysis of temperature behavior of optical absorption edge is performed for non-crystalline materials where the Urbach behavior is observed (SiO2), with deviations from the Urbach behavior (20PbO · 80SiO2) and with a mixed behavior (As2S3). For glassy As2S3, the Urbach behavior of the absorption edge in a limited temperature range is explained from the point of view of two components of structural disordering – static and dynamic. A parallel red shift of the absorption edge in As2S3 and, consequently, the temperature-independent Urbach energy at T < 300 K, are related to the lack of medium-range order in the atomic arrangement in the presence of short-range order.
